MA 145
Medical Law and Ethics
Southwestern Illinois College · UGRD · Fall 2026
3 sections
Catalog description
Medical Law & Ethics is acourse designed to introduce the student to legal and ethical issues in the medical field. This course will provide an introduction into the legal terminology, regulations, licensure of the various allied health fields, ethical standards, professional liability, documentation and professional responsibilities.
